What Are Sausage Egg Breakfast Roll-Ups?

Sausage Egg Breakfast Roll-Ups – Quick & Easy Morning Treat! are a baked breakfast pastry made by rolling cooked sausage, scrambled eggs, and cheese inside crescent roll dough. Once baked, the dough turns golden and flaky, creating a satisfying contrast to the soft, savory filling inside.

Think of them as a breakfast burrito meets a croissant, but simpler, lighter, and easier to prepare.

Ingredients for Sausage Egg Breakfast Roll-Ups – Quick & Easy Morning Treat!

Each ingredient plays an important role in making these roll-ups flavorful, satisfying, and easy to assemble.

Main Ingredients

  • 6 breakfast sausage links (fully cooked)
    Pork, turkey, or chicken sausage all work well.

  • 4 large eggs
    The base of the filling—fluffy and protein-packed.

  • 1 tablespoon milk
    Helps make the scrambled eggs tender and creamy.

  • Salt and pepper, to taste
    Simple seasoning enhances the eggs.

  • 1 tablespoon butter
    Adds richness and prevents sticking.

  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
    Melty, sharp, and classic—but customizable.

  • 1 can (8 oz) refrigerated crescent roll dough
    The flaky wrapper that brings it all together.


Step-by-Step Instructions

Follow these steps carefully to make perfect Sausage Egg Breakfast Roll-Ups – Quick & Easy Morning Treat! every time.

1. Preheat and Prepare

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per to prevent sticking and make cleanup easy.

2. Scramble the Eggs

In a b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, salt, and pepper until fully combined. Melt butter in a skillet over medium heat, then add the egg mixture. Gently scramble until the eggs are just set but still soft. Remove from heat immediately—overcooked eggs will become dry in the oven.

3. Prepare the Dough

Unroll the crescent dough and separate it into triangles along the perforations. Lay them flat on a clean surface.

4. Assemble the Roll-Ups

At the wide end of each triangle:

  • Spoon a small amount of scrambled eggs

  • Sprinkle with shredded cheddar cheese

  • Place one sausage link on top

5. Roll and Bake

Carefully roll each triangle from the wide end toward the point, tucking the filling inside. Place seam-side down on the prepared baking sheet.

Bake for 15–20 minutes, or until the roll-ups are golden brown and fully cooked.

6. Serve and Enjoy

Let cool slightly before serving. Enjoy warm for the best flavor and texture.


Tips for Perfect Sausage Egg Breakfast Roll-Ups

Don’t Overcook the Eggs

Soft scrambled eggs finish cooking in the oven and stay fluffy inside the roll-ups.

Use Shredded Cheese

Pre-shredded cheese melts evenly, but freshly shredded cheese offers better flavor.

Keep Fillings Balanced

Overfilling can cause roll-ups to burst open during baking.

Bake Seam-Side Down

This helps keep the roll-ups sealed and neatly shaped.

Make-Ahead and Meal Prep Tips

Refrigerating

Bake the roll-ups, allow them to cool completely, then store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.

Freezing

Wrap each roll-up individually in foil or plastic wrap, then store in a freezer-safe bag for up to 2 months.

Reheating

  • Oven: 350°F for 10–12 minutes

  • Air Fryer: 350°F for 5–7 minutes

  • Microwave: 30–60 seconds (best for speed, less crisp)

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make these without crescent dough?

Yes, puff pastry or biscuit dough can be used, though baking times may vary.

Can I make them gluten-free?

Use gluten-free crescent dough or wraps if available.

Are these good for kids?

Absolutely—these are soft, cheesy, and easy to eat.

Can I double the recipe?

Yes, this recipe scales perfectly for larger batches.
